'[Java]' 카테고리의 다른 글
java 에서 숫자의 자릿수 알아내기 (1) | 2018.01.20 |
---|---|
RxJava (0) | 2016.02.23 |
BigInteger 최대공약수 gcd 최소공배수 lcm 구하기 (0) | 2016.02.22 |
java 로 클립보드 사용하기 (0) | 2015.10.30 |
java 로 동영상 처리 (0) | 2015.10.28 |
java 에서 숫자의 자릿수 알아내기 (1) | 2018.01.20 |
---|---|
RxJava (0) | 2016.02.23 |
BigInteger 최대공약수 gcd 최소공배수 lcm 구하기 (0) | 2016.02.22 |
java 로 클립보드 사용하기 (0) | 2015.10.30 |
java 로 동영상 처리 (0) | 2015.10.28 |
ssh 접속이 느려서 이것저것 테스트를 해봤는데
아이피를 입력하면 접속이 빠른데 hostname 을 입력하면 접속이 느렸다
그래서 /etc/ssh/ssh_config 파일에 AddressFamily inet 를 추가해줬다
기본은 AddressFamily any 가 주석처리 돼있다
http://jeromejaglale.com/doc/mac/fix_ssh_connection_delays
위 글에서 2015년 12월 29일 댓글 참고.
vim syntax highlight 컬러 적용 (0) | 2016.03.02 |
---|---|
맥에서 ls color 바꾸기 (0) | 2015.06.24 |
CentOS 6.7 에서 SVN Repository 를 구축하고 http 로 접속한다.
<PROJECT>, <USERNAME>, <PASSWORD> 는 각자에 맞게 설정한다
# root 로 작업
# 1.7 로 할 경우만 설치
wget http://opensource.wandisco.com/rhel/6/svn-1.7/RPMS/x86_64/mod_dav_svn-1.7.22-1.x86_64.rpm
wget http://opensource.wandisco.com/rhel/6/svn-1.7/RPMS/x86_64/subversion-1.7.22-1.x86_64.rpm
wget http://opensource.wandisco.com/rhel/6/svn-1.7/RPMS/x86_64/subversion-tools-1.7.22-1.x86_64.rpm
# 1.6 으로 할 경우
yum install subversion mod_dav_svn
mkdir -p /var/www/svn/repos
cd /var/www/svn/repos
svnadmin create --fs-type fsfs <PROJECT>
vim /etc/httpd/conf.d/subversion.conf
# WANdisco Subversion Configuration
# For more information on HTTPD configuration options for Subversion please see:
# http://svnbook.red-bean.com/nightly/en/svn.serverconfig.httpd.html
# Please remember that when using webdav HTTPD needs read and write access your repositories.
# Needed to do Subversion Apache server.
LoadModule dav_svn_module modules/mod_dav_svn.so
# Only needed if you decide to do "per-directory" access control.
LoadModule authz_svn_module modules/mod_authz_svn.so
# 2016-08-07 hskimsky add
SVNAdvertiseV2Protocol Off
<Location /svn/repos>
DAV svn
# SVNPath /opt/repo/
SVNParentPath /var/www/svn/repos
### /svn 로 access 할 경우 Repository 를 List 를 보여주려면 on 으로 설정한다.
SVNListParentPath on
AuthType Basic
AuthName "SVN Repo"
AuthUserFile /var/www/svn/conf/svn.passwd
Require valid-user
## Path-Based Authorization 를 사용할 경우 설정한다.
AuthzSVNAccessFile /var/www/svn/conf/svn-access-file
</Location>
mkdir -p /var/www/svn/conf
touch /var/www/svn/conf/svn.passwd
htpasswd -b /var/www/svn/conf/svn.passwd <USERNAME> <PASSWORD>
vim /var/www/svn/conf/svn-access-file
[<PROJECT>:/]
* = r
@admin = rw
@<PROJECT>-developers = rw
[groups]
<PROJECT>-developers = hskimsky
admin = hskimsky
chown -R apache:apache /var/www/svn
아래 URL 접속하고 위에서 입력한 USERNAME, PASSWORD 입력하고 보이면 성공!
http://<SERVER>/svn/repos/<PROJECT>
참고
centos 6.5 에서 oracle jdk7 설치하기 (0) | 2015.02.26 |
---|---|
centos 6.5 에서 postgresql 설치하기 (0) | 2015.02.23 |
CentOS 6.5 에 influxdb 설치하고 실행하기 (0) | 2015.02.12 |
CentOS 6.5 에 glances 설치하기 (0) | 2015.02.12 |
HAWQ resource manager 를 yarn 으로 설치 시 pgadmin 연결 불가 (2) | 2016.06.18 |
---|---|
Apache HAWQ 2.0 build and install in cluster (0) | 2016.06.05 |
Apache HAWQ 2.0 build and install (0) | 2016.05.28 |
Pivotal Greenplum 설치 (0) | 2022.08.28 |
---|---|
postgresql 9.4, postgis 설치하기 (0) | 2015.08.06 |
postgresql 에서 테이블 정보 추출하기 (0) | 2015.03.03 |
pgadmin 설치 (0) | 2015.02.23 |
PostgreSQL과 MySQL의 차이점 (0) | 2015.02.23 |
HelloJNI.c 작성
아래 명령어 실행
결과
Apache HAWQ 2.0.0 을 resource manager 를 yarn 으로 설치 후 pgadmin 으로 연결하려고 하자
pg_resqueue table 이 없어서 연결이 안되고
hawq yarn application 이 재시작 되었다.
그래서 Pivotal HAWQ 2.0.0 을 설치하기로 하고 그 전에 HDP 를 설치했다.
http://hskimsky.tistory.com/111
그리고나서 pgadmin 으로 HAWQ 에 연결하려고 하자 여전히 yarn 에서 hawq 가 재시작됐다.
왜 이러는지 문서를 더 찾아보든가 committer 에게 문의하든가 해야겠다
apache hawq 에서 postgis 를 사용하기 (0) | 2016.07.31 |
---|---|
Apache HAWQ 2.0 build and install in cluster (0) | 2016.06.05 |
Apache HAWQ 2.0 build and install (0) | 2016.05.28 |
http://docs.hortonworks.com/HDPDocuments/Ambari-2.2.2.0/bk_Installing_HDP_AMB/content/index.html
위 url 을 따라가면서 설치 진행했다
CentOS 6.7
jdk 1.7.0_80
HDP 2.4.2.0 with Ambari 2.2.2.0 (Pivotal HAWQ 2.0.0 포함 전체)
리눅스 서버 4대로 구성해봤다
1번 서버에 Ambari Server, NameNode, HAWQ Master, 그 외 각종 Master
2번 서버에 Secondary NameNode, Resource Manager, HAWQ Standby Master, 그 외 각종 Master
3,4번 서버에 DataNode, Node Manager, HAWQ segment, HBase Region Server
PHD 3.0.1.0-1 과 거의 비슷했다
다만 HDP 설치 도중 /usr/hdp/current/xxx-client/conf 디렉토리가 없다고 오류가 날 경우가 있었는데
그냥 수동으로 만들어주고 다시 Retry 를 해서 설치했다
HAWQ 2.1.1.0 에서 pljava 활성화 (0) | 2017.04.08 |
---|
직접 작성한 문서입니다
Apache Hadoop 2.7.2 버전 위에 HAWQ 2.0 dev 버전을 resource manager 를 yarn 으로 설치하고 HAWQ 에서 hdfs 와 web 의 파일을 읽어서 external table 을 만드는 것을 목표로 합니다.
Apache HAWQ 를 build, install 하는 순서와 명령어를 아주 자세하게 적어놓았습니다.
hadoop install 방법은 포함하지 않았고 pxf install 을 포함하고 있습니다.
먼저 챕터별 전체 실행 스크립트를 적어놓았고 그 뒤에 부분별 실행 스크립트를 적어놓았고 그 다음에 실행 한 결과 로그를 적어놓았습니다.
문서는 asciidoc 으로 작성하였으며 repository 내에 asciidoc 파일 및 pdf 파일도 포함되어 있습니다.
잘못된 점이 있으면 hskimsky@gmail.com 으로 메일 주시기 바랍니다.
빌드 성공을 기원합니다.
apache hawq 에서 postgis 를 사용하기 (0) | 2016.07.31 |
---|---|
HAWQ resource manager 를 yarn 으로 설치 시 pgadmin 연결 불가 (2) | 2016.06.18 |
Apache HAWQ 2.0 build and install (0) | 2016.05.28 |
CentOS 6.7
Oracle JDK 1.7.0_80
Apache Maven 3.3.9
Python 2.6.6
Apache Hadoop 2.7.2
Apache HAWQ 2.0.0.0 dev
PXF 3.0.0
위 사양으로 설치 완료
Apache HAWQ build 만 6개월정도 삽질 한 듯..
문서에서는 gcc 버전을 4.7.2 이상 쓰라는데
centos 6.7에서 gcc 버전 4.7.2 로 올리면 yum 이 안됨
(나는 그냥 default 인 4.4.7 로 했음)
kernal 옵션 설정시 본인의 사양과 잘 비교하면서 할 것. 부팅이 불가할 수도 있음
semaphore 설정은 필수임
PXF 설치도 자잘하게 해줘야 할 것들이 많음
PXF 는 51200 port 로 실행하고 external table location 의 port 도 51200 으로 사용함
지금은 single node 로 구성했는데
조만간 vm 4개정도로 HAWQ HA 구성까지 하면서 메뉴얼 작성 해봐야겠다
apache hawq 에서 postgis 를 사용하기 (0) | 2016.07.31 |
---|---|
HAWQ resource manager 를 yarn 으로 설치 시 pgadmin 연결 불가 (2) | 2016.06.18 |
Apache HAWQ 2.0 build and install in cluster (0) | 2016.06.05 |